Closest to Moab of the many BLM campgrounds along the scenic route. During COVID, half are closed, but this was open. Very busy and campsites are hard to come by. We stayed first night in center campsite closer to road but moved to a riverside campsite for two nights. Campsite (#15) had a path down to the Colorado River, which we dipped into periodically during the raging midday heat. Backs to a sheer canyon wall that marks a border of Arches NP. Passable Verizon service. Clean pit toilet.

Location is 5 star. Some sites pretty large. Road noise from highway during day but reasonably quiet at night. Tough to get in. Show up early in morning. Also talk to camp host if full - he is very helpful and will let you know when people are leaving.
